This Month’s Issue: Carolina Country Scenes

Toward the end of November, the Carolina Country team gets together for what I now count among my holiday season traditions: the annual judging of the reader photo contest. It’s always a joy to see what has been submitted from all across the state, typically with ample artful shots of sunsets, mountain views, coastal starry skies, butterflies, and— usually met with a collective “awww” from our group— cute kids and animals.

—Scott Gates, editor
